An enzyme cannot be used in any random reaction, the active site on an enzyme can only catalyze certain substances. Think of them as keys that only work for 1 lock.

What simple experiment might you perform to test the hypothesis that an enzyme combines with its substrate when it acts?

You could perform a simple enzyme activity assay. Mix the enzyme with its substrate and monitor the reaction rate over time using a spectrophotometer to measure any changes in absorbance or using a colorimetric assay to detect product formation. Compare the reaction kinetics with a control group lacking either the enzyme or the substrate to determine if the enzyme-substrate combination is necessary for the reaction to occur.

What determines the shape of an enzymes active site?

The shape of an enzyme's active site is determined by its amino acid sequence, which folds into a specific three-dimensional conformation. This unique shape allows the enzyme to interact selectively with its specific substrate, forming an enzyme-substrate complex for catalysis to occur. Any alterations to the active site's shape can affect the enzyme's function.

What is a specific enzyme?

A specific enzyme is an enzyme that only changes the speed of ONE reaction. (It only acts on one particular substance that happens to be compatible with that enzyme) i.e. if enzyme A is specific to reaction A, it will change the speed of reaction A. However it will have no effect on any other reaction like reaction B or C.


After the enzyme catalyzes the reaction is it changed in any way?

The enzyme does not undergo any permanent changes during the catalytic reaction; it simply facilitates the reaction by lowering the activation energy. At the end of the reaction, the enzyme is released unchanged and can participate in further reactions.

What does the shape of an enzyme have to do with how well the enzyme works?

The shape of an enzyme is crucial for its function because it determines the enzyme's specificity and ability to interact with its substrate. The specific shape allows the enzyme to bind to its substrate, facilitating the reaction. Any changes in the enzyme's shape can affect its ability to catalyze the reaction effectively.


The primary function of an enzyme or any biological catalyst is to?

The primary function of an enzyme or any biological catalyst is to increase the rate of a chemical reaction by lowering the activation energy barrier, thereby facilitating the conversion of substrate molecules into products. This process allows cells to efficiently carry out metabolic reactions necessary for growth, maintenance, and energy production.

Why are enzymes three dimensional shape so important?

An enzyme's three dimension shape is important to the binding that occurs between the enzyme itself and its specific substrate, forming the enzyme-substrate complex. In order for the enzyme to create a reaction it is important that the shape of the enzyme binds the substrate to the active site where the chemical reaction occurs. One other thing to consider is the shape that the enzyme takes that allows only its specific substrate to bind and not any other molecule.
